Transaction 750ec0c92a1dde83aaec96265020fafdce44b1f51b2cac4189ae59e03f95c375

2 Input
2 Outputs
  • 750ec0c92a1dde83aaec96265020fafdce44b1f51b2cac4189ae59e03f95c375:0
  • value  956845
    address  38BYHQmMYidA1wLGaJFhcz4XEGNcKJ4LXz
  • 750ec0c92a1dde83aaec96265020fafdce44b1f51b2cac4189ae59e03f95c375:1
  • value  35719
    address  1NaBaSBRHFP1vyQ8ufeFnfjEW5n8UJWYxp